Mohs Hardness Scale National Park Service

National Park Service The Mohs Hardness Scale is used as a convenient way to help identify minerals A mineral s hardness is a measure of its relative resistance to scratching measured by scratching the mineral against another substance of known hardness on the Mohs Hardness Scale

Hardness Vickers Rockwell Brinell Mohs Shore and Knoop Matmatch

The Mohs hardness test is one of the earliest attempts at defining and comparing the hardness of mineral materials The Mohs scale consists of values from 1 to 10 which correlate with the ability of the test material to withstand scratching by progressively harder minerals It is typically used for geological purposes

Difference Between Quartzite & Granite Sciencing

Quartzite offers an approximate value of 7 on the Mohs scale while granite offers a hardness value of between 6 and 6 5 on the Mohs scale Quartzite is often employed in the creation of railway ballasts and borders for flowerbeds Granite is often mined in slabs for the fabrication of tiles gravestones and countertops

What Is the Hardness of Limestone Hunker

Mar 26 2022As a sedimentary rock formed by sediment settling and compacting together over a long period of time limestone often contains fossils As far as hardness is concerned limestone averages 3 to 4 on a scale of 1 to 10 and it s harder than gypsum but considerably softer than granite

Granite McGill University

Granite is nearly always massive hard and tough and it is for this reason it has gained widespread use as a construction stone The average density of granite is 2 75 g·cm −3 with a range of 1 74 g·cm −3 to 2 80 g·cm −3 The word granite comes from the Latin granum a grain in reference to the coarse grained structure of such a crystalline rock

Mohs scale of mineral hardness Simple English Wikipedia the free

Mohs scale of mineral hardness is named after Friedrich Mohs a mineralogist Mohs scale is ordered by hardness determined by which minerals can scratch other minerals Rocks are made up of one or more minerals According to the scale Talc is the softest it can be scratched by all other materials Gypsum is harder it can scratch talc but not calcite which is even harder
